Introduction to Server Rental

When you're looking to host a website or need additional storage for your business, server rental offers a flexible and cost-effective solution. Unlike purchasing a server outright, renting provides access to state-of-the-art technology without the large upfront investment. This makes server rental an attractive choice for businesses of all sizes. With server rental, you can scale your resources up or down based on your current needs, ensuring your business stays agile and adaptable.

Benefits of Server Rental

Renting a server comes with multiple benefits that make it an appealing option for businesses. One of the main advantages is the reduced financial burden. By renting, you avoid the significant costs associated with purchasing and maintaining physical hardware. Server rental also provides you with access to the latest technology, keeping your business competitive without constant upgrades. Furthermore, renting servers allows businesses to easily scale resources up or down depending on their needs, which is vital as companies grow and change.

Server Rental Offers Flexibility and Scalability

Flexibility is a keyword when discussing server rental. Businesses often experience fluctuating demands, and with rental services, you can quickly adjust storage and bandwidth as required. This scalability ensures you can handle peak traffic times without overspending during quieter periods. Such flexibility is especially crucial for seasonal businesses or those with unpredictable traffic patterns. Having a scalable solution means only paying for what you actually use, optimizing your operational expenses.

Server Rental vs. Ownership

Many people wonder about the differences between renting a server and owning one. While owning a server gives you complete control, it also requires a significant initial investment and ongoing maintenance. Renting, on the other hand, minimizes these burdens since the server provider takes care of hardware updates, repairs, and maintenance. This allows you to focus more on your core business activities instead of worrying about server downtime and technical issues.
